时间:2024-10-14 来源:网络 人气:
随着汽车工业的快速发展,电子控制单元(ECU)软件系统已成为汽车电子系统中的核心组成部分。本文将探讨ECU软件系统在现代汽车电子中的应用,以及所面临的挑战。
ECU软件系统是指安装在汽车电子控制单元中的软件程序,它负责控制和管理汽车的各种电子设备。ECU软件系统通常由以下几个部分组成:
微控制器(MCU):作为ECU的核心,负责执行软件指令和控制硬件设备。
传感器数据采集:通过传感器获取汽车运行状态信息,如速度、温度、压力等。
执行器控制:根据软件指令,控制执行器(如电机、阀门等)执行相应动作。
通信接口:实现与其他ECU或车载网络通信,如CAN总线、LIN总线等。
发动机管理系统:优化发动机性能,提高燃油经济性和排放标准。
车身电子系统:实现车窗、座椅、灯光等功能的自动化控制。
安全系统:如防抱死制动系统(ABS)、电子稳定程序(ESP)等。
信息娱乐系统:提供导航、音乐、视频等功能。
自动驾驶系统:实现车辆自动泊车、车道保持、自适应巡航等。
随着汽车电子技术的快速发展,ECU软件系统也面临着诸多挑战:
复杂性增加:随着汽车电子系统功能的不断增加,ECU软件系统的复杂性也随之提高。
实时性要求:ECU软件系统需要满足实时性要求,确保汽车在各种工况下安全稳定运行。
安全性要求:随着自动驾驶等技术的应用,ECU软件系统的安全性要求越来越高。
软件更新和维护:随着汽车电子技术的快速发展,ECU软件系统需要不断更新和维护,以满足市场需求。
模块化设计:将ECU软件系统划分为多个模块,提高系统可维护性和可扩展性。
实时操作系统(RTOS):采用RTOS提高软件系统的实时性。
功能安全设计:遵循ISO 26262等标准,确保ECU软件系统的安全性。
持续更新和维护:定期更新和维护ECU软件系统,以满足市场需求。
ECU软件系统在现代汽车电子中扮演着重要角色,随着汽车电子技术的不断发展,ECU软件系统将面临更多挑战。通过采用模块化设计、RTOS、功能安全设计等策略,可以有效应对这些挑战,推动汽车电子技术的持续发展。